Ah, the magic phrase. > How about: > > As far as I can tell, both Intel and AMD consider it to be > architecturally valid for XRSTOR to fail with #PF but nonetheless change > user state. The actual conditions under which this might occur are > unclear [1], but it seems plausible that this might be triggered if one > sibling thread unmaps a page and invalidates the shared TLB while > another sibling thread is executing XRSTOR on the page in question. > > __fpu__restore_sig() can execute XRSTOR while the hardware registers are > preserved on behalf of a different victim task (using the > fpu_fpregs_owner_ctx mechanism), and, in theory, XRSTOR could fail but > modify the registers. If this happens, then there is a window in which > __fpu__restore_sig() could schedule out and the victim task could > schedule back in without reloading its own FPU registers. This would > result in part of the FPU state that __fpu__restore_sig() was attempting > to load leaking into the victim task's user-visible state. > > Invalidate preserved FPU registers on XRSTOR failure to prevent this > situation from corrupting any state. > > [1] Frequent readers of the errata lists might imagine "complex > microarchitectural conditions".
